dock_to_right
arrow_back
Terminology chevron_right Descriptions chevron_right 658538011 - Ileocecal actinomycosis (disorder) (en)
Production
-
Language with ID “8e57970c-c258-5309-ad2b-bf235e172313” doesn’t exist. Perhaps it was deleted?